The invention is directed to compounds and methods for treating protein folder disorders. In certain embodiments the invention provides compounds and methods for treating neurodegenerative diseases such as Alzheimer's disease, tauopathy, cerebral amyloid angiopathy, Lewy body disease, dementia, Huntington's disease and prion-based spongiform encelopathy. The invention further provides compounds, methods and pharmaceutical compositions for inhibiting tau protein, Aβ protein or α-synuclein protein aggregation.
